NT52 CGX is a 2003 Fiat Seicento in Grey with a 1,108c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 2003 Fiat Seicento models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.3% with a typical mileage of 41,903 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Seicento f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 40,977 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NT52 CGX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Seicento typ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 23 years old, this Fiat Seicento is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
